This is a new perfume release for this year. I came across it by pure chance when I was asked to choose some free samples when I made a FeelUnique.com order. This scent was one of the two I chose to receive. It is Irresistible by GIVENCHY and it is a 1ml spritzer sample of the eau de parfum. “ Rose effervescent. Luscious rose dancing with radiant blond wood ” It contains a mixture of notes such as; Pear, Ambrette, Rose, Iris, Virginia Cedar and Musk. When it is first sprayed, it kind of smells like soap. As it starts to dry down, it still smells slightly soapy but the ambrette, rose, iris and musk notes start to peek through. Once it has fully dried down it smells less soapy and more florally. It is definitely a more soft mature scent. It does smell nice, fresh and does remind me of spring. It isn’t a scent I am typically drawn to, so I probably will not buy a bottle of it.
